A Tragic Accident

Commentators like John Gill clarify that the phrase "she lay upon it" (or "overlaid it") describes a tragic accident. The mother, deep in sleep, unintentionally rolled over and smothered her infant. This detail is crucial as it establishes the death was not malicious, setting the stage for the other woman's deceitful claim.
